Queen St. House, Queen Street, Twyford, Winchester, SO21 1QG
Off Market
374 m²
EPC Data
Square metres | 374 m² |
Property Type | Detached House |
EPC Rating | D |
Square metres | 374 m² |
Property Type | Detached House |
EPC Rating | D |